marvel It was in the building for New York Comic-Con 2025, and in addition to posting comic book and collaboration news, the entertainment company provided updates on its 2026 convention. Disney Plus TV list. Fans will be able to see X-Men ’97 return for a second season in 2026 alongside other series, such as Daredevil: Born Again.

One of its biggest announcements is the new offering, Vision Queststarring Paul Bettany and Age of Ultron’s James Spader, who also reprises his role as Ultron. The next series will arrive in 2026 and conclude the three-part story that began with WandaVision and continued with Agatha along. Along with Bettany and Spider, fans will be able to see Ruriad Mollica as Wanda and Vision’s son, Tommy, James D’Arcy as Jarvis, and Orla Brady as Friday.

What will come in 2026? Here’s a look at what Marvel shared during the event on their Disney Plus releases:

  • X-Men ’97 It returns for a second season in summer 2026 with Apocalypse revealed as the villain.
  • Daredevil: Born Again, Season 2 will premiere in March 2026 with Krysten Ritter as Jessica Jones.
  • Season 2 of Your Friendly Neighborhood Spider-Man will feature Daredevil and Venom in fall 2026.
  • Wonder Man will debut on Tuesday, January 27 at 6pm PT/9pm ET. Watch the new trailer below.
